Kani Sefid (Persian: كاني سفيد, also Romanized as Kānī Sefīd)[1] is a village in Gol Tappeh Rural District, Ziviyeh District, Saqqez County, Kurdistan Province, Iran. At the 2006 census, its population was 166, in 37 families.[2] The village is populated by Kurds.[3]
